Wetland ecosystems are among the most productive ecosystems in the biosphere. Wetlands receive surface water inputs from streams (surface run off), precipitation and overland flow and subsurface water inputs from surface infiltration. Biodiversity refers to the variability among living organisms from all sources including inter alia, terrestrial, freshwater and marine aquatic ecosystems and the ecological complexes of which they are the part. Hosetti has described it as the library of life, i.e., variety of all genes, species of microorganisms, plants animals and ecosystems that are found on our planet. Phytoplankton has varied in physical and chemical requirements for population growth. Diatoms differ significantly with respect to motility, cell-wall composition and ornamentation, and nutritional and reproductive strategies. In present study we investigate relationship between Chlorophyll concentration and their impact on Microbial diversity with Physicochemical-Parameters. Sodav Bandharan is a temporary wetland near to Vellan Village, Kodinar.
